Reduced-contaminant deformable bullet, preferably for small arms

1. A deformable bullet having a front part tapering towards the tip of the bullet and a rear, substantially cylindrical part, the bullet comprising a jacketless bullet body, in the tapering, front part of which there extends a cavity centrally relative to the longitudinal axis of the bullet, characterised in that the cavity comprises an opening at the front part of the bullet having a chamfered edge, a cylindrical part extending rearwardly therefrom, and at least one conical part adjacent thereto and extending rearwardly therefrom, in that a forcing-open plunger forms the bullet tip, in that the forcing-open plunger comprises a head sealing the opening of the cavity, the head having a rearwardly facing conical part, and a shank extending into the cavity and in that the head is supported with its conical part on the chamfered edge of the opening to the cavity.
